Dancing Through the Scandal: Mariana Seoane's Bold Declaration of Love

Mariana Seoane's song 'Escándalo' in collaboration with La Sonora Dinamita is a vibrant and defiant declaration of love that challenges societal norms and gossip. The word 'escándalo' translates to 'scandal' in English, and the repetition of this word throughout the song emphasizes the central theme of a love affair that is considered scandalous by the public eye. The lyrics describe a relationship that is kept hidden, likening it to a love that is 'stronger than a volcano' and suggesting a passionate and intense connection between the lovers.

The song's narrative conveys the struggle of maintaining a relationship that is frowned upon by society. The lovers are 'hidden from the moon,' indicating that they must keep their love secret. However, the protagonist expresses a rebellious attitude, stating that they do not care about the rumors and censorship of their name throughout the city. This defiance is further highlighted by the lines 'Este río desbordado / No se puede controlar' ('This overflowing river / Cannot be controlled'), which metaphorically represents the unstoppable nature of their love.

Mariana Seoane's performance, combined with the infectious rhythm of cumbia by La Sonora Dinamita, turns the song into an anthem for those who choose to live their lives on their own terms, regardless of societal judgment. The lyrics 'Vivo mi vida / Soy como soy' ('I live my life / I am as I am') encapsulate the message of self-acceptance and the refusal to conform to others' expectations. The song encourages listeners to embrace their choices and love boldly, even if it means causing a scandal.
